An exceptional answer
When conducting research and analysis for sustainable design projects, my approach is driven by a deep understanding of sustainable construction principles and practices. I begin by thoroughly comprehending the project requirements, objectives, and constraints, ensuring alignment with green building standards like LEED, BREEAM, or WELL. To gather data, I employ a combination of primary research, such as site visits and interviews with experts, and secondary research, including academic publications, industry reports, and case studies. I utilize advanced environmental assessment and energy modeling tools, such as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) and EnergyPlus, to evaluate the environmental impact, energy performance, and life cycle cost of design alternatives. Through this analysis, I identify key sustainability opportunities and propose innovative strategies, such as passive design techniques, green roofs, or renewable energy integration. Collaborating closely with architects, engineers, and contractors, I ensure the seamless integration of sustainable materials, energy-efficient systems, and water conservation measures throughout the design process. I apply my proficiency in CAD software and BIM to visualize and iterate on the design, optimizing energy performance and occupant comfort. Additionally, I proactively communicate and advocate the tangible benefits of green building to clients, stakeholders, and team members, utilizing data-driven presentations, well-crafted articles, and interactive workshops. To stay at the forefront of the field, I actively participate in industry conferences, engage in research collaborations, and contribute to sustainable design publications. By demonstrating unwavering commitment to sustainability, I aim to create lasting positive impacts on our built environment.

How to prepare for this question
- Familiarize yourself with green building standards like LEED, BREEAM, and WELL. Understand their principles and the certification processes.
- Stay up-to-date with industry trends and advancements in sustainable design by reading industry publications, attending conferences, and participating in workshops.
- Develop a strong understanding of environmental assessment and energy modeling tools, such as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) and EnergyPlus.
- Highlight your experience in project management and leadership, as they are crucial for success in this role.
- Describe specific examples from past projects where you successfully integrated sustainable materials, energy-efficient systems, or renewable energy technologies.
